The coverage includes extensive regional print media reporting (across Rajasthan editions) on the successful conduct of the oncology CME in Jodhpur by RGCIRC, focused on recent advances in breast cancer and CAR-T cell therapy.The sessions were led by Dr. Rajeev Kumar, Senior Consultant and Chief of Breast Onco Surgery (Unit-I), who discussed recent updates in breast cancer with emphasis on personalised, multidisciplinary care and hereditary breast cancers, and Dr. Narendra Agrawal, Unit Head and Senior Consultant, Hemato-Oncology, Leukemia and Bone Marrow Transplantation, who elaborated on the scientific basis, indications and transformative potential of CAR-T cell therapy in select hematological malignancies. The coverage underscores the programme’s focus on evidence-based updates, patient-centric treatment strategies and the growing role of advanced cellular therapies in contemporary oncology practice.
